From folklore to fantasy, children’s literature to sci-fi, humans have always written tales of magic and wonder that relate the human to the non-human world. At a time of ecological crisis this imaginative capacity for ‘serious play’ is needed more than ever. Join the University of Glasgow’s Centre for Fantasy and the Fantastic for a series of speed dating presentations exploring how fantasy engages us with climate emergency, before handing over to authors Ruth EJ Booth and Oliver Langmead for an interactive creative writing session inspired by the evening’s conversation.
